Impact of Managerial Overconfidence on Earnings Management --- The Moderating Roles of Accounting Conservatism
碩士 === 國立中興大學 === 會計學研究所 === 107 === This study examines the relationship between managerial overconfidence and earnings management, and considers the moderating effect of accounting conservatism.
